My daughter and I have been in residence on E. Maynard for 10 days, and we're still unpacking and organizing, but I'm already touched by the sense of community here.
Yesterday, my daughter and I were walking to the bus stop to go grocery shopping. The people on our block introduced themselves and invited us to an 8 p.m. movie in their backyard. And we went, and under the harvest moon we watched El Mariachi and became acquainted with our new neighbors.
Good people. I'm still in the midst of settling in--our place isn't fit for visitors yet--but backyard movies definitely make me like this block. Is that the new Welcome Wagon?
